Chickpea ("the app," "we," "us") is a mobile app that lets parents and guardians record and caption their children's voice memories. This policy explains what information the app collects, how it's used, and how you can control or delete it.
Chickpea is designed to be used by an adult parent or guardian, not directly by a child. Any audio, photos, or names you add to the app are provided voluntarily by you, about your own child, under your control.
Information we collect
Voice recordings. When you record a memory, the audio file is saved on your device. If you subscribe to Chickpea Pro and link a Google account, that audio file is also uploaded to our cloud storage (provided by Google Firebase) so it isn't lost if you lose or replace your device.
Captions and kid profiles. Captions and kid names you enter stay on your device only. They are not uploaded to the cloud, even for Pro subscribers — only the audio file itself is backed up.
Profile photos. Photos you add for a kid's profile are stored on your device and, if cloud sync is enabled, uploaded to your private cloud backup. They are never publicly accessible.
Google account information. If you choose to link a Google account (only required for Chickpea Pro's cloud backup), we receive your name, email address, and profile photo from Google, used solely to identify your account and associate your backups with you. We do not post on your behalf or access any other Google data.
Subscription information. If you purchase Chickpea Pro, payment is handled entirely by Google Play (or Apple, if applicable) and our subscription management provider. We do not see or store your payment card details.
What we don't collect
Chickpea does not include advertising, analytics, or third-party tracking software of any kind. We don't sell or share your data with advertisers or data brokers, ever.
How your data is stored and secured
Cloud backups are stored using Google Firebase. Each account's files are isolated so that only that account can access them — files are not publicly accessible. Data is encrypted in transit and at rest by Firebase's standard infrastructure.
Your controls
- Export your data — you can export all recordings as audio files at any time from the Account screen. We strongly recommend doing this regularly as your own backup.
- Deleting a recording or kid profile in the app permanently deletes it from your device and, if it was backed up, from cloud storage too.
- Turning off sync stops new recordings from being backed up; previously synced files remain in your account until deleted.
- Logging out of your Google account stops local access to your backup but does not delete your cloud data — signing back in with the same Google account restores access.
- Deleting your account and all data — use the "Delete account and all data" option in Account settings, or contact us at support@chickpea.app and we will delete your cloud-stored data within 30 days.
Children's privacy
Chickpea is not directed at children and is not designed for children to use directly. It is a tool for parents and guardians to privately record and caption their own child's voice memories. We do not knowingly collect information directly from children.
